Understanding Macronutrients

Macronutrients are the nutrients required in larger amounts that provide the energy necessary for body functions and workouts. They consist of:

  1. Proteins: Essential for muscle repair and growth.
  2. Carbohydrates: The primary source of energy for high-intensity workouts.
  3. Fats: Important for hormone production and overall health.

Importance of Macronutrient Ratios

The optimal macronutrient ratio can differ based on several factors, including the type of steroid cycle, individual body composition, and specific fitness goals. Here are some key considerations:

  1. Protein Intake: Generally, a higher protein intake (1.5 to 2 grams per kilogram of body weight) is recommended during steroid cycles to support muscle synthesis.
  2. Carbohydrate Management: Complex carbohydrates should form the bulk of your caloric intake, especially during bulking cycles to fuel workouts and replenish glycogen stores.
  3. Healthy Fats: Fats should not be neglected. They play a crucial role in hormone health, especially during a cycle, so ensure you’re consuming adequate amounts (20-30% of total calories) from sources like avocados, nuts, and olive oil.

Adjusting Ratios Based on Cycle Phases

Depending on the phase of your steroid cycle—bulking or cutting—macronutrient ratios will need to adjust:

  1. Bulking Cycle: Focus on higher carbohydrates (50-60% of calories), moderate protein (25-30%), and lower fats (15-20%). This helps to maximize muscle gains.
  2. Cutting Cycle: Increase protein intake (30-40% of calories) to preserve muscle while reducing carbs (30-40%) to promote fat loss. Fats can remain moderate (20-30%).
